Gestión de una Columna Incorrecta
Entonces, has recibido el resultado object
. Esto significa que el tipo de la columna es no numérico, pero para calcular los valores necesarios, la columna debe ser numérica. Cambiemos eso.
- Primero, es necesario reemplazar
-
por.
. Para ello, se aplica el método.str.replace()
para sustituir el carácter en la cadena de la columna del conjunto de datos. La sintaxis es
data['column_name'].str.replace('old_symbol','new_symbol')
En este caso,old_symbol
es-
, y.
esnew_symbol
; - Luego, convertir la columna al tipo de
data
float. Para ello, se utiliza el método.astype()
. La sintaxis esdata['column_name'].astype('type')
.
En este caso, el tipo es'float'
.
Swipe to start coding
Su tarea es:
- Seguir el algoritmo anterior y primero reemplazar
-
por.
en la columna'Fare'
. - Convertir la columna
'Fare'
al tipo de dato'float'
. - Mostrar el tipo de la columna
'Fare'
.
Solución
¡Gracias por tus comentarios!
single
Pregunte a AI
Pregunte a AI
Pregunte lo que quiera o pruebe una de las preguntas sugeridas para comenzar nuestra charla
Can you show me how to apply these changes to a specific column?
What should I do if there are missing values in the column?
Is there a way to check if the conversion was successful?
Awesome!
Completion rate improved to 3.03
Gestión de una Columna Incorrecta
Desliza para mostrar el menú
Entonces, has recibido el resultado object
. Esto significa que el tipo de la columna es no numérico, pero para calcular los valores necesarios, la columna debe ser numérica. Cambiemos eso.
- Primero, es necesario reemplazar
-
por.
. Para ello, se aplica el método.str.replace()
para sustituir el carácter en la cadena de la columna del conjunto de datos. La sintaxis es
data['column_name'].str.replace('old_symbol','new_symbol')
En este caso,old_symbol
es-
, y.
esnew_symbol
; - Luego, convertir la columna al tipo de
data
float. Para ello, se utiliza el método.astype()
. La sintaxis esdata['column_name'].astype('type')
.
En este caso, el tipo es'float'
.
Swipe to start coding
Su tarea es:
- Seguir el algoritmo anterior y primero reemplazar
-
por.
en la columna'Fare'
. - Convertir la columna
'Fare'
al tipo de dato'float'
. - Mostrar el tipo de la columna
'Fare'
.
Solución
¡Gracias por tus comentarios!
single